WebJun 16, 2024 · The higher the number, the glossier the film is. When interpreting gloss, make sure to keep in mind the angle it is being measured from. The most common is 45 degrees but this measurement can be skewed by using a different angle. WebThe blown film process is characterized by simultaneous stretching of the molten polymer in machine direction ... The DDR equals the haul-off speed divided by the melt delivery rate, and the BUR is calculated as the quotient of the bubble diameter at the frost line and the die diameter.
